// DEFAULT_TILE_BATCH sets how many images the Shrikecut CLI resizes per
// worker pass. Plugin authors: hooks fire once per batch, not per image,
// so keep per-batch state cheap. Raising this trades memory for throughput;
// the resizer mmaps sources, so large batches on network mounts will stall.
// Plugins must not mutate this at runtime — fork the config instead.
// For bug reports, include the token printed below this constant.

pipeline stamp: htk21_117f26d8d4a22b34e7542

The Plumeline address autocomplete widget queries the internal Wayfern resolver on every keystroke after the third character, debounced at 180 ms. Release builds must pin resolver schema v4; older schemas silently drop unit numbers. Before tagging the release, verify the widget authenticates with the internal key that follows below.

API key for kahop-bagef: zpat2_yb

- [ ] **Confirm holiday-period opening hours.** Over the Wintermoot break, Delverhal Depot runs night shift only from 22:00 to 05:30, with the main roller door locked from midnight. Check the rota board by the loading bay before your round. Entry through the rear airlock requires the code below.

door code, yagap-bahof: bdg-O-05

## Scrubline 4.0 — Changed Defaults

Support note: EXIF scrubbing is now on by default for all uploads, not just public albums. GPS tags, serial numbers, and maker notes are stripped; orientation is preserved. Users who want metadata kept must opt out per album. Expect tickets about "missing camera info" — that's expected behavior now. The shipped defaults are as follows.

config for kagup-hahig:
druwyn:
  pin: 2801
  metrics_host: metrics.druwyn.zemvarlabs.internal
  tenant: sorius
  seal: seal_798a43d7